Applications:
1) Action: plant growth regulator with systemic properties. It penetrates into plant tissue, and is
decomposed to ethylene; which affects growth processes.
2) Uses: widely used to accelerate ripening of fruits, tomato, sugar beet, coffee, etc; to increase the
tillering of wheat and rice; to prevent lodging in rice, maize and flax; to accelerate boll opening and
defoliation in cotton; to hasten the yellowing of mature tobacco leaves; to stimulate latex flow in
rubber trees, and resin flow in pine trees; to stimulate early uniform hull split in walnuts; etc.
Toxicology:
1) Oral: acute oral LD50 for rats 4229mg/kg
2) Skin and eyes: acute percutaneous LD50 for rabbits 5730mg/kg. Irritating to skin and eyes
3) Inhalation: LC50 (4h) for rats 6.26mg/L4) NOEL: (2y) for rats 3000ppm diet5) ADI: (JMPR)
0.05mg/kg b.w.6) Birds: acute oral LD50 for bobwhite quails 1072mg/kg7) Fish: LC50 (96h) for carp
